



















Trained as a historian, Dr. Barbara McDonald Stewart will speak about the diary of her father Ambassador James G. McDonald from 1933-1950 – the day-to-day recording of the extraordinary insight and observations of the times and meticulous recollections of his personal meetings with Hitler, Pope Pius XII, President Roosevelt, David Ben Gurion and others. Though not written for publication and never revised, Dr. Stewart understood the important historical significance of the diary in allowing them to be published. She will add her own reflections on history for the years when she accompanied her father as America’s first Ambassador to the new State of Israel in 1948. When her mother could not join her father, 21-year old Barbara served as the official embassy hostess where she met and entertained Israel’s political leaders and visiting dignitaries from around the world.
